5:30 am: Situation update with breaks today in Ukraine

It’s 6:30 a.m. in Ukraine, and Russian forces made no significant progress overnight:

– In Kiev, Ukrainian forces claimed that they repelled a Russian “attack” on Victory Street. Fierce battles were heard throughout the night, but they remained relatively isolated.

Ukrainian forces claimed to have shot down two IL-76 military transport aircraft. The information has not been independently confirmed. If so, it would be a major victory for Ukraine’s anti-aircraft defense, which is seen as a major weakness. These aircraft can carry up to 150 paratroopers and light armor.

– In the south, the city of Kherson was severely damaged but the former spokesman for Zelensky confirmed at 6 am (local time) that the city was still under Ukrainian control.
